Hi there, and welcome to JustAnswer, I look forward to assisting you today with your question and providing the best answer possible.Can you do the following on the iPhone please.Go to Settings, Wifi. Press on your network, then the right arrow and choose Forget Network.Then hold the Home Button and Power button for about 10 seconds until you see the Apple Logo.When you see this, release the buttons and let the phone reset.Once it has, reconnect to the wifi and enter in the password.If you still have the problem, please let me know Before Rating My Service.Thank You.

ok, if you are using Wep, this can be the problem.But first, I just want to double check that we have the correct password.On the computer that is connected to the Wireless, can you click Start (windows logo button bottom left)Type in the search box Wireless Networks and press enter on the keyboard.Right click on your network that is in the list and select properties.Click on SecurityPut a check in the check box Show CharactersThis will display the Network Security KeyCan you make sure please, this is the text you are entering on the iPhone. Capitals need to be entered as Capitals.If you have confirmed it is the correct password, please let me know.
